黑狐家游戏

关系型数据库的介绍与应用,关系型数据库,核心技术与应用解析

欧气 0 0

本文目录导读:

  1. 关系型数据库概述
  2. 关系型数据库的核心技术
  3. 关系型数据库的应用

关系型数据库概述

关系型数据库(Relational Database)是一种以关系模型为基础的数据库,它将数据组织成一张或多张二维表,通过行和列来表示实体和实体之间的关系,关系型数据库在20世纪70年代诞生,至今已广泛应用于各个领域,成为数据存储和管理的首选方案。

关系型数据库的核心技术

1、关系模型

关系模型是关系型数据库的理论基础,它将数据表示为一张张二维表,每个表由行和列组成,行代表一个实体,列代表实体的属性,关系模型的特点如下:

(1)数据结构简单,易于理解;

关系型数据库的介绍与应用,关系型数据库,核心技术与应用解析

图片来源于网络,如有侵权联系删除

(2)数据冗余度低,便于数据维护;

(3)数据独立性高,便于数据共享;

(4)数据完整性良好,便于数据校验。

2、关系代数

关系代数是关系型数据库的操作语言,它以集合论为基础,对关系进行操作,关系代数主要包括以下运算:

(1)选择(Select):从关系中选取满足条件的行;

(2)投影(Project):从关系中选取满足条件的列;

(3)连接(Join):将两个关系通过公共属性连接起来;

(4)并(Union):将两个关系合并为一个关系;

(5)差(Difference):从一个关系中减去另一个关系。

3、SQL语言

关系型数据库的介绍与应用,关系型数据库,核心技术与应用解析

图片来源于网络,如有侵权联系删除

SQL(Structured Query Language)是关系型数据库的标准查询语言,它包含了数据定义、数据查询、数据操纵和数据控制等功能,SQL语言的特点如下:

(1)简单易学,易于上手;

(2)功能强大,可满足各种数据操作需求;

(3)兼容性好,支持多种关系型数据库。

4、数据库管理系统(DBMS)

数据库管理系统是关系型数据库的核心组成部分,它负责管理数据库的存储、查询、维护和备份等操作,DBMS的主要功能如下:

(1)数据定义:定义数据库的结构,包括表、视图、索引等;

(2)数据操纵:执行数据查询、更新、删除等操作;

(3)数据维护:保证数据的完整性和一致性;

(4)数据备份与恢复:保证数据的可靠性和安全性。

关系型数据库的应用

1、企业信息管理

关系型数据库的介绍与应用,关系型数据库,核心技术与应用解析

图片来源于网络,如有侵权联系删除

关系型数据库在企业信息管理中具有广泛的应用,如客户关系管理(CRM)、供应链管理(SCM)、企业资源规划(ERP)等,通过关系型数据库,企业可以实现对各类信息的集中存储、高效查询和实时更新。

2、电子商务

电子商务领域对数据存储和管理有着极高的要求,关系型数据库能够满足这一需求,在电子商务平台中,关系型数据库可以用于存储商品信息、订单信息、用户信息等,为用户提供便捷的购物体验。

3、金融行业

金融行业对数据的安全性、可靠性和实时性要求极高,关系型数据库在金融领域具有广泛应用,如银行、证券、保险等金融机构,通过关系型数据库存储和管理客户信息、交易数据、账户信息等,确保金融业务的顺利进行。

4、科学研究

关系型数据库在科学研究领域也发挥着重要作用,科研人员可以利用关系型数据库存储和管理实验数据、研究成果、科研文献等,提高科研工作的效率。

5、教育行业

教育行业对数据的管理同样具有较高要求,关系型数据库在教育领域得到广泛应用,如学校管理系统、在线教育平台等,通过关系型数据库存储和管理学生信息、课程信息、教师信息等,提高教育教学质量。

关系型数据库作为一种成熟、稳定的数据存储和管理技术,在各个领域发挥着重要作用,随着技术的不断发展,关系型数据库将继续在数据管理领域发挥重要作用。

标签: #关系型数据库的介绍

黑狐家游戏
  • 评论列表

留言评论